In Illustrator I created a compound path of a few paths which I wanted to help the fpd with. But because they're not overlapping I can see tenth of color pickers which isn't that comfortable for the costumer.
I need help! How to solve this problem? Can there be implemented a method where you can choose the paths to have an color picker together?

At the moment you can only select to have one color-picker per path or one color picker per color - If you have any suggestions for other ways to implement a general solution please post about it in the feature request forum (as we can't think of another way at the moment).
